NVIDIA

Senior CAD Engineer - DFX Software

Taiwan, Taipei Full time

We are now looking for a Systems Software Engineer. Do you like to think creatively and enjoy solving challenges that require innovation? If so, we may have an opportunity for you. In Our team we define and build methodologies, Software, and flows tailored to the field of Silicon device testing, Silicon debug, and Silicon failure analysis. We owe our success to our people, some of the brightest in the world, and a company culture that fosters and encourages innovation, and fuels our creativity!

Our team contributes to the advancement of all the fields in which NVIDIA participate, from gaming to building groundbreaking state-of-the-art compute platforms and Artificial Intelligence, by enabling high quality Silicon defect screening to sustain all these fields. This often requires new ways of thinking in order to meet new challenges, and we pride ourselves in our ability to tackle these challenges in ways that enable our success. If you are a like-minded person who enjoys innovation and likes to solve technical challenges then we would love to hear from you!

What you'll be doing:

  • Work with design team to understand Hardware specification for Software development and design and implement these requirements.
  • Develop software in modern C++ and various scripting languages to enable design and development of software enabling efficient test pattern generation, application of these patterns on Silicon, failure analysis, and yield learning
  • Investigate optimization approaches so our software can run on GPUs
  • Utilize AI tooling for software workflows, code generation and optimization
  • Integrating advanced tools for CI/CD, code quality, and automated testing

What we need to see:

  • Excellent communication skills and strong understanding of hardware and software concepts
  • MS or higher degree in EE or CS (or equivalent experience) with 8+ years of experience
  • 5+ years of strong experience in C++ and Modern C++ development in fields related to Silicon testing and Automatic Test Equipment (ATE)
  • Strong software design and debug skills in a Linux environment
  • Good knowledge of standard DevOps workflows and processes
  • 2+ years of Python and scripting skills
  • Familiarity with BDD and TDD software development practices

Ways to stand out from the crowd:

  • Knowledge of Design for Test (DFT) including fault models, ATPG, and fault simulation
  • Interest to grow technically and explore new fields such as in Deep Learning and A.I.
  • CUDA and AI/ML knowledge as good to have